    Brother Machines Using TN-750 Toner

    Is anyone out there having as much trouble with the fusers on these machines as I am? Some of the machines that use this fuser are the DCP-8110, HL-5440, MFC-8950, etc. The fuser part number is Brother LU9809001. The problem starts with blurry prints or prints with a smudge, specially on the bottom of horizontal lines. After that you start getting fuser jams. On some of these models it is cheaper to buy a new machine than to pay for parts and labor. I have an MFC-8950 at a customers office that is still under warranty and Brother has sent a tech to replace the fuser twice in the span of 10 months. (They would not send the fuser to me to replace because I am not an authorized Brother repair shop).
